Bug#531122: please build-depend on unversioned boost devel packages

Steve M. Robbins smr at debian.org
Sat May 30 04:38:44 UTC 2009


Package: wesnoth
Severity: normal

Hi,

Your package depends on the Boost 1.37 development packages, which
will make it fail to build when 1.37 is removed.  Please depend on the
unversioned Boost development packages [1].
